CSS外邊距是指元素周圍的空白區域,它可以用來控制元素與其他元素和頁面邊界之間的距離。在計算CSS外邊距時,有幾個因素需要考慮。
元素的盒子模型
在CSS中,每個元素都有一個盒子模型,它包含了元素的內容、內邊距、邊框和外邊距。在計算CSS外邊距時,需要了解元素的盒子模型,并且考慮其影響。
盒子模型示意圖
元素的盒子模型示意圖如上所示。在計算CSS外邊距時,需要考慮元素的外邊框、邊框和內邊距的寬度,以及元素的寬度和高度。
margin屬性
CSS外邊距可以使用margin屬性進行控制。margin屬性具有四個值,分別控制元素的上、右、下、左四個方向的外邊距。這些值可以是正數、負數或百分比值,甚至可以是auto。在計算CSS外邊距時,需要根據這些值進行合理的計算。
相鄰元素的影響
相鄰元素的外邊距會影響到一起。如果兩個元素相鄰,它們之間的外邊距會合并成一個值。這種情況被稱為外邊距合并。在計算CSS外邊距時,需要考慮相鄰元素的外邊距合并情況。
css代碼示例
p { margin: 10px 20px 30px 40px; }
以上代碼表示控制段落元素的上、右、下、左四個方向的外邊距分別為10px、20px、30px、40px。
綜上所述,在計算CSS外邊距時,需要考慮元素的盒子模型、margin屬性值、相鄰元素的外邊距合并等因素,才能得出正確的結果。希望本文能夠對您在CSS外邊距的計算和應用中有所幫助。